*CASED JOHN RIGBY & CO. DBL RIFLE. Cal. 375 H&H. SN 381755. Made in Paso Robles, CA. This fine rifle has 26” bbls, pedestal mounted front sight and 2-leaf platinum line express sight with claw mounts on a quarter rib with the caliber engraved between mounts. Accompanied by claw mount rings containing a Leupold 1.5-5X scope with fine duplex crosshairs. It has a Greener crossbolt rib extension with dbl underlugs, ejectors & dbl triggers. Mounted with very highly figured, honey & chocolate, marble cake, Circassian walnut with checkered, square edge, splinter forearm and pistol grip stock with raised side panels and shadow cheekpiece, 15” over a Decelerator pad. Boxlock receiver has side reinforcements & side clips and is very nicely engraved with about 80% coverage beautiful foliate arabesque patterns with fine stippled background and a shoulder bust of a maned lion on the bottom. All the appended metal is engraved to match with about 4” of engraving over chamber area of bbls and about 2-1/2” on each side of muzzles. The engraver’s signature, “B. BURGESS”, is on the trigger plate. Grip cap is engraved with the orig owner’s initials “WMB”. Also accompanied by its orig aluminum Americase embossed on top with maker’s name and lined with blue velvet, embroidered in lid in white with maker’s name & crest. Additionally accompanying are instruction sheets & warranty. CONDITION: Extremely fine, as new, probably unfired, retaining virtually all of its orig factory finish with strong bright blue bbls & bright metal receiver, having been polished from case coloring for engraving. Wood is sound and retains virtually all of its orig factory finish with no discernible flaws. Scope is equally new, as is the case. 4-31158 JR452 (15,000-20,000)
